Birth Injury

A birth injury attorney could assist a family with filing an action for medical malpractice against the hospital or doctor who acted with negligence during labor and delivery. A successful legal action could result in financial compensation to help the family cover the medical expenses of their child as well as future costs, as well as the loss of wages and emotional trauma.

A skilled birth injury attorney will be able to review the medical documents of your child, pinpoint any negligence-related issues and then hire experts to investigate the case. They are typically other doctors in the field of OB/GYN who are able to provide their opinion on the extent of malpractice. After the experts have examined your case, your lawyer will be able to determine who was responsible for the injuries and name them as defendants in the lawsuit.

In all states, including New York, there is a deadline to file an injury claim before the court, referred to as the statute of limitations. It usually lasts 30 months or 2 1/2 years after the malpractice.

During this period, your attorney will work with your insurance company to negotiate an agreement on your behalf. Your attorney will file a suit in the appropriate court if the insurance company is unwilling to pay a reasonable amount. A judge and Calera Birth Injury Lawyer jury will decide the case. This is a complicated procedure that should be handled by an experienced professional.
